A blockbuster winter exhibition featuring some of history’s most famous international artists is about to open at the National Gallery of Australia.
Cézanne to Giacometti brings works from the Museum Berggruen, Berlin to Australia for the first time, including pieces by Paul Cézanne, Pablo Picasso, Georges Braque, Henri Matisse, Paul Klee and Alberto Giacometti.
We take an inside look at the major showcase, which charts how groundbreaking European artists and their Australian counterparts influenced each other across the twentieth century.
